CW1 5QF is a compact residential postcode in Cheshire East, covering just 7.5 hectares with a population of 1,388 people. Its high population density of 18,537 people per square kilometre reflects its small, tightly knit character. Situated 2.5 miles north-east of Crewe, the area blends historical roots with modern convenience. Haslington, the village at its heart, has grown from a rural chapelry into a suburban parish, with its population rising sharply from 667 in 1801 to 6,536 in 2011. The presence of Haslington Hall—a 16th-century timber-framed manor—adds historical weight to the area. Daily life here is shaped by proximity to Crewe’s transport hubs and the M6 motorway, while the village retains a quiet, residential feel. With 87% of homes owner-occupied, the community is stable, and the area’s compact size means amenities and services are within easy reach.
